I have this small porcelain bird figurine marked with incised crown and C.V. 110?
According to my research, this mark dates it to the 30’s-1950’s. But here are my issues: First, not sure Hummel made birds that early.
Second, the mold number doesn’t seem to match up to anything I can find.
Any help would be appreciated. Thanks!

Not to be nit=picky, but to help you in research: The bird is not a Hummel. A Hummel figurine is one based on the drawings of Maria Innocentia Hummel. Hummels are one line of Goebel porcelain.

Although I'm not familiar nor have I owned any Hummels or bird figurines as old as your item, I have a large collection of Hummels from the 90s and newer and can say that without a doubt, their desirability and collectability has all but disappeared!
While trying to thin a collection during the last 10 years, I've found that I can barely give them away. I've listed them at 10% (or lower) than original retail and they sit (and sit and sit). I've tried auctions, starting at $2.99 and even then, very few have sold and most were with just a single bid! (These are Hummels for which I'd originally paid $100 to $300.)
So in answer to your question about value, my experience says that there's not much value!
